Village Hall News

Many may have heard that 50% of the Village Halls in Yorkshire are closing because of the lack of volunteers. This was linked by some to the new Licensing Act. This has certainly caused us a bit of a problem but we are now through it.

The old one page "Occasional Licence" (cost £10) for the sale of Liquor has been replaced by a new 20 page "Temporary Event Notice" (TENs) (cost £21). At least 14 days notice has to be given and it may be longer. The new Act comes into effect on 24 November but no documentation or final details have been received at the time of writing (18 November).

Therefore we are not sure about the detailed procedure but we do know that a TEN can only be requested if the Committee has given its permission as we only allowed 12 TENs per annum.

Because of increased oil and electricity costs there will be some price increases from 1 January 2006. This will not affect events already booked.
